Definitions from Wiktionary (Simun)
▸ noun: Alternative spelling of simoom [A hot, dry, suffocating, dust-laden wind of the desert, particularly of Arabia, Syria, and neighboring countries, generated by the extreme heat of the parched deserts or sandy plains.]
